How much does it cost to rent an apartment in El Presidio?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
El Presidio Studio Apartments | $1,242 | $600 | $2,300 |
El Presidio 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,444 | $560 | $2,549 |
El Presidio 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,778 | $440 | $3,191 |
El Presidio 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,679 | $625 | $3,600 |
El Presidio 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,664 | $799 | $4,400 |
El Presidio 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,481 | $1,239 | $2,300 |
